I'm not looking to "beat EQ" inside a week; what I enjoyed about Project1999 is the real "look and feel" of playing EQ back when I started in 1999-2000. What made it really cool was you could go into a noob zone like Crushbone and find as many as 20 players. Getting a group was easy too.

They have a "no-boxing" rule (tracked by IP address) which kind of annoyed me at first but now I fully understand the rationale. Without being able to box, and without being able to twink, everybody HAS to find a group and that makes it easy TO find a group, even under level 10.
